Hydroformylation of olefins in the presence of α,β-unsaturated aldehydes

V. Macho

Research Institute for Petrochemistry, Nováky

 

Abstract: Expts. on the hydroformylation of propylene (Ia) proved the inhibitive and retardative effect of α,β-unsatd. aldehydes (I). E.g., at 150°, with the addn. of 0.2% Co by wt. (as Co2(CO)8 or Co stearate) and in the presence of 20% by wt. (calcd. on Ia) of 2-ethyl-2-hexenal or crotonaldehyde, the hydroformylation of Ia is retarded and at 30% is almost completely arrested. Simultaneously, the catalytically active Co carbonyls react with I to form inactive complex compds. When the amt. of Co is larger (0.8%), and esp. with hydrogenation, I gradually disappear to form satd. aldehydes or alcs. The inhibiting action of I can be counteracted by using higher temps. and addns. of alcs. (butanol). It was recommended to add alc. in the ratio % wt. OH/Br no. ≥0.15, if the solvent for hydroformylation of olefins contains I.
